Believe it or not, the courts don’t always rule in favor of the mother, at least when there are celebrities involved. In recent years we’ve seen some ugly custody battles end in a victory for the father. Here’s a look at some of those famous fathers who have prevailed.

MATT BARNES

NBA player Matt Barnes is the latest celebrity male to win sole custody of his children. On Thursday, a Los Angeles family court judge ruled in his favor and granted him sole physical and legal custody of his 10 year old twin boys. Barnes has been at war with his ex-wife Gloria Govan for years — and now a judge has granted him not only custody but also an 18-month restraining order against Govan. The restraining order was granted through May 2020 — but does not extend to the kids because the judge doesn’t believe Gloria poses a danger to them. According to the agreement Govan will get regular visitation and is also allowed to have dinner with the kids every Wednesday evening. She must also complete 26 sessions of anger management and 10 parenting classes.

LUDACRIS

The rapper won primary custody of his daughter, Cai Bella, after an ongoing court battle with Tamika Fuller. He decided to try and go after custody when Fuller made a big fuss about wanting $15,000 in monthly child support. According to reports, the fact that Fuller was living way above her means and that she went MIA for some time after the birth of her eldest daughter, hurt her case.

USHER

The custody battle between Usher Raymond and his ex-wife Tameka Raymond ranged from nasty to downright sad. But no matter what you thought of Tameka, the idea of her losing custody of her sons with Usher, Usher Raymond V and Naviyd, after the death of her son Kile, was pretty heartbreaking. She claimed his “status” helped him win. In 2012 he was granted custody, and in 2013, Tameka took him back to court for temporary custody after their son, Usher, almost drowned in a pool at the singer’s home.  Her request was denied.

DWYANE WADE

If their divorce settlement took years to complete, then you know good and well that coming to an agreement on custody was going to be rough. Ultimately Wade wound up winning sole custody of his sons, Zaire and Zion, from ex-wife, Siohvaughn Funches Wade, in 2011. She has since claimed that the NBA star left her broke and homeless and has interfered on more than one occasion with visitation. Wade has since re-married actress Gabrielle Union and also gained custody of his nephew Dahveon Morris.

LENNY KRAVITZ

Back in 2001 Lenny Kravitz, was granted primary custody of his daughter Zoe, after her mother Lisa Bonet gave up custody. According to reports Zoe, then 12, wanted to live with her father so that they could get closer. The set-up seemed to work because the two seem to becloser than ever. Not to mention, Lenny, Lisa, her new partner Jason Momoa and Zoe are all very close.

KEITH SWEAT 

Keith Sweat and Lisa Wu, formerly of “Real Housewives of Atlanta,” have two sons from their marriage–Jordan and Justin. He was awarded primary custody of the boys in 2003 after a judge said they lacked structure due to her business ventures, and Wu spending a reckless amount of money on herself. The boys couldn’t even appear on RHOA when she was on the show, but that was because Sweat wouldn’t sign a waiver to have his sons exposed to reality TV.
